X-Flight is a steel Wing Coaster at Six Flags Great America in Gurnee, Illinois. The 3,000-foot (910 m) long ride will feature barrel rolls and high-speed drops, It opened for season passholders on May 12, 2012 and today it opens to the public (May 16, 2012)
